Tabnine Logo
SimpleAttributeDefinitionBuilder.setValidator
Code IndexAdd Tabnine to your IDE (free)

How to use
setValidator
method
in
org.jboss.as.controller.SimpleAttributeDefinitionBuilder

Best Java code snippets using org.jboss.as.controller.SimpleAttributeDefinitionBuilder.setValidator (Showing top 20 results out of 315)

orig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der.setValidator(new EnumValidator<>(BackupFailurePolicy.class));
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der.setValidator(new EnumValidator<>(BackupStrategy.class));
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der.setValidator(new EnumValidator<>(Mode.class));
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der.setValidator(new EnumValidator<>(EvictionType.class));
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der.setValidator(new EnumValidator<>(ProtocolVersion.class));
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der.setValidator(new EnumValidator<>(ExhaustedAction.class));
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der.setValidator(new EnumValidator<>(IsolationLevel.class));
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der
        .setValidator(new IntRangeValidator(-1, true, true))
        .setCorrector(ZeroToNegativeOneParameterCorrector.INSTANCE)
        ;
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der.setAllowExpression(false).setValidator(new EnumValidator<>(LoadMetricEnum.class));
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der.setDefaultValue(new ModelNode(StartMode.LAZY.name()))
        .setValidator(new EnumValidator<>(StartMode.class))
        ;
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der.setDefaultValue(new ModelNode("org.jgroups"))
        .setValidator(new ModuleIdentifierValidatorBuilder().configure(builder).build())
        ;
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der.setDefaultValue(new ModelNode("org.wildfly.clustering.server"))
        .setValidator(new ModuleIdentifierValidatorBuilder().configure(builder).build())
        ;
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der
        .setMeasurementUnit(MeasurementUnit.SECONDS)
        .setValidator(new IntRangeValidator(-1, true, true))
        .setCorrector(ZeroToNegativeOneParameterCorrector.INSTANCE)
        ;
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der.setDefaultValue(new ModelNode("org.jboss.as.clustering.infinispan"))
        .setValidator(new ModuleIdentifierValidatorBuilder().configure(builder).build())
        ;
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der.setValidator(new IntRangeValidatorBuilder().min(1).configure(builder).build());
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der.setValidator(new IntRangeValidatorBuilder().min(1).configure(builder).build());
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der.setValidator(new DoubleRangeValidatorBuilder().lowerBound(0).upperBound(Float.MAX_VALUE).configure(builder).build());
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der.setValidator(new IntRangeValidatorBuilder().min(0).configure(builder).build())
        .setMeasurementUnit(MeasurementUnit.MILLISECONDS)
        ;
  }
},
origin: wildfly/wildfly

  @Override
  public SimpleAttributeDefinitionBuilder apply(SimpleAttributeDefinitionBuilder builder) {
    return builder.setValidator(new LongRangeValidatorBuilder().min(0).configure(builder).build())
        .setMeasurementUnit(MeasurementUnit.MILLISECONDS)
        ;
  }
},
origin: wildfly/wildfly

Attribute(String attributeName, ModelType type, CapabilityReference capabilityReference) {
  this.definition = new SimpleAttributeDefinitionBuilder(attributeName, type)
      .setRequired(false)
      .setFlags(AttributeAccess.Flag.RESTART_RESOURCE_SERVICES)
      .setAllowExpression(false)
      .setCapabilityReference(capabilityReference)
      .setValidator(new StringLengthValidator(1))
      .setAccessConstraints(SensitiveTargetAccessConstraintDefinition.SSL_REF)
      .build();
}
org.jboss.as.controllerSimpleAttributeDefinitionBuildersetValidator

Popular methods of SimpleAttributeDefinitionBuilder

  • build
  • <init>
  • setAllowExpression
  • setDefaultValue
  • create
  • setRequired
  • setFlags
  • setStorageRuntime
  • setCapabilityReference
  • setDeprecated
  • setMeasurementUnit
  • setRestartAllServices
  • setMeasurementUnit,
  • setRestartAllServices,
  • setXmlName,
  • setAccessConstraints,
  • setAlternatives,
  • addAccessConstraint,
  • setAttributeMarshaller,
  • setCorrector,
  • addAlternatives

Popular in Java

  • Making http post requests using okhttp
  • orElseThrow (Optional)
    Return the contained value, if present, otherwise throw an exception to be created by the provided s
  • startActivity (Activity)
  • getApplicationContext (Context)
  • Rectangle (java.awt)
    A Rectangle specifies an area in a coordinate space that is enclosed by the Rectangle object's top-
  • ConnectException (java.net)
    A ConnectException is thrown if a connection cannot be established to a remote host on a specific po
  • Date (java.sql)
    A class which can consume and produce dates in SQL Date format. Dates are represented in SQL as yyyy
  • ConcurrentHashMap (java.util.concurrent)
    A plug-in replacement for JDK1.5 java.util.concurrent.ConcurrentHashMap. This version is based on or
  • Pattern (java.util.regex)
    Patterns are compiled regular expressions. In many cases, convenience methods such as String#matches
  • Modifier (javassist)
    The Modifier class provides static methods and constants to decode class and member access modifiers
  • Top Sublime Text plugins
Tabnine Logo
  • Products

    Search for Java codeSearch for JavaScript code
  • IDE Plugins

    IntelliJ IDEAWebStormVisual StudioAndroid StudioEclipseVisual Studio CodePyCharmSublime TextPhpStormVimGoLandRubyMineEmacsJupyter NotebookJupyter LabRiderDataGripAppCode
  • Company

    About UsContact UsCareers
  • Resources

    FAQBlogTabnine AcademyTerms of usePrivacy policyJava Code IndexJavascript Code Index
Get Tabnine for your IDE now